Transaction 588a8cf1f08ce580d78451f03cf4a8b568c471edfac64072b857d2aa2243eed7
1 Input
1 Output
-
588a8cf1f08ce580d78451f03cf4a8b568c471edfac64072b857d2aa2243eed7:0
- value
- 107623
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be19e4708e19d13704c1e8a76705078ae04d5500 OP_EQUAL
- address
- 3K2BL2HiPH5ztuizMWrPFHLngDqX3wmAFf